WWE SmackDown Ratings, Viewership Up For Crown Jewel Fallout

Brandon Thurston of Wrestlenomics has the viewership details for Friday’s edition of WWE SmackDown on FOX, which featured the return of the show to its flagship network after airing on FS1 the prior week. SmackDown notched 2.249 million viewers, which is up five percent from its previous episode on FOX.

In the key 18 to 49 demographic, SmackDown posted as a 0.58 rating with 759,000 viewers, and that’s up 12 percent from the prior FOX show.

The show ranked No. 4 on cable on Friday behind the MLB playoff game on FS1 and two NBA games on ESPN.

Thurston notes that in comparing numbers on Showbuzz Daily, Friday’s TV competition may have been the toughest in many weeks due to the viewership for the programs in the top 150.

SmackDown featured Brock Lesnar being “suspended” for his actions, a noteworthy title exchange between Becky Lynch and Charlotte Flair, and much more.
